Audio Database

AU-D707
Commentary

A DC pre-main amplifier with a 3 DC amplifier configuration with a diamond actuation circuit mounted on the equalizer section.

The equalizer, flat amplifier / tone amplifier, and power amplifier are all DC amplifiers. The direct coupling method is adopted in which input capacitors of all stages are eliminated.
The straight DC amplifier configuration provides pure music signal transmission and a wide range.
The inputs of all block stages are FET inputs with low-noise, high-gm characteristics and a full push-pull input circuit.
In addition, each block stage greatly reduces the harmful dynamic distortion in the target circuit configuration.

The power amplifier section follows the circuit configuration of the AU-D907.
In other words, the first stage is equipped with a constant-current operation circuit using dual FET that has excellent low-noise characteristics and allows large current to flow, and the second stage is equipped with a diamond complimentary service circuit using dual differential with improved dynamic characteristics to enhance the drive capability of the pre-drive stage.
In addition, SANSUI Custom NM (Non Magnetic) transistor with excellent linearity is used for the power stage, and it has a symmetrical circuit structure with good dynamic characteristics and excellent sound quality.

The MC head amplifier is a fully symmetrical push-pull configuration with stable performance even for transient input.
The first stage uses low-noise transistors with carefully selected P-channel and N-channel combinations, and the unique symmetrical symmetrical circuit configuration realizes improved dynamic characteristics.

The equalizer amplifier uses a direct-coupled method without input capacitors, which interfere with sound quality, and is equipped with a diamond differential circuit.
The first stage consists of low noise, high gm, differential input with dual FET, cascode bootstrap and constant current circuit, the second stage consists of a diamond differential circuit and current differential push-pull, and the output stage consists of a SEPP circuit with Darlington connection.

The flat / tone amplifier is a direct-coupled DC amplifier configuration without input capacitors.
The first stage is a differential circuit with a cascode connection and constant current using a dual FET of low noise and high gm, the second stage is a current differential push-pull circuit with a current mirror, and the output stage is a SEPP configuration with a two stage Darlington connection to reduce TIM distortion.
In addition, the tone control circuit is a CR type with good variable characteristics, and combined with the tone selector, simple characteristics can be obtained.
When the jump switch is used, the signal jumps through the flat amplifier and directly enters the power section.

An EI transformer is used for the power supply.
The power amplifier section is supplied with two dedicated windings and two rectifier circuits in which the left and right channels are completely independent. Large-capacity electrolytic capacitors (15,000 μ Fx4) and metalized capacitors are used.
In addition, a constant voltage circuit with a separate dedicated winding is adopted for the preamplifier section to suppress the occurrence of TIM distortion and envelope distortion, while taking into consideration factors that lead to improved sound quality such as improved resolution.

The speaker system can be connected in two ways : OFF, A, B, and A + B. When used in the A system, it can be connected directly to the DC power amplifier stage at the shortest distance without passing through the speaker selector switch, and high quality sound can be obtained.

Equipped with subsonic filter (16 hz, -3dB, 6dB/oct), loudness switch, tone jump switch, balance control, and 2-circuit tape play / copy function.

Three spare AC outlets (100W for one interlocked circuit, 250W for two non-interlocked circuits)

Ground terminal mounted

Pre and power can be separated.

Model Rating
Type Wide-range DC pre-main amplifier
Power Amplifier Unit
Effective power 90W + 90W (10 Hz to 20 kHz, THD 0.008%, 8 Ω)
90W + 90W (1 kHz, THD 0.003%, 8 Ω
Total harmonic distortion factor 0.008% or Less (10 Hz to 20 kHz, 8 Ω at Effective Output)
Intermodulation distortion factor (70 hz : 7 khz = 4 : 1) Not more than 0.008%
Output bandwidth 3 Hz ~ 70 kHz (IHF, double-channel operation, 1 kHz, 8 Ω)
Damping factor 100 (IHF, Double-channel Operation, 1 kHz, 8 Ω)
Frequency characteristic DC ~ 500 kHz, + 0 -3dB
Input Sensitivity / Impedance (1 kHz) 1V/47k Ω
Signal-to-noise ratio 125 dB or more (IHF, A-network, short circuit)
Channel Separation (IHF, 1 kHz) 90 dB or more
Rise time 0.5 μ sec
Slew rate ± 200 V / μ sec
